SALVATION ARMY
SELF-DENIAL WEEK.
By Telegraph—Press Association.
WELLINGTON, Last Night
The collections for* the Salvation Army Self-denial were announced at the meeting at the Citadel to-night. The North Island collection was £8709, as against £7776 \ for last year. The South Island gave £5820 as against £5688 for last year. The total amount raised in New Zealand was £14,529, compared with £13,464 last year. The principal amounts were:— Wellington £1330, Gisborne 1175, Hastings £3OO.
